Output ee26523623498c6e657f097fbc8cf0818d51d1fe217cef0e0d39a47480131c91:74

value
73129
script pubkey
OP_0 OP_PUSHBYTES_20 e66d29b3ed128a7aad1cc7a8565f4eed8553f05c
address
bc1quekjnvldz2984tguc759vh6wakz48uzu4v2x54
transaction
ee26523623498c6e657f097fbc8cf0818d51d1fe217cef0e0d39a47480131c91